About Perth (PER)

Perth is the capital and the largest city of the Australian City of Western Australia. The central business district of this city is bordered by Swan River to the south and east, and with Kings Park to its west. Central Park is the tallest building in Perth; it is the seventh largest building in Australia. Summers in Perth are hot and dry, whereas winters are cool and wet. The year goes with high seasonal rainfall. Though finding the lack of bustling in this city, one would think that the city bears an air of dulness. But that's no truth, since the land abounds with natural beauty on one hand and with a large number of restaurants, bars and cultural activity, that you will never have a listless moment here. There are always ongoing some kind of activity within, across and outside the city. You can have any of these entertainment activities, which are- Day Cruises, Day Trips, Bicycle Hire, Walking Tours, Cruises, Helicopter Tours, Night Cruises and Whale Watching. Subiaco Hotel is popular for Sunday sundowner and a quite beverage. Have your favorite drink in Polynesian-themed bar, Hula Bula Bar. La Bog is a famous crowded Irish pub, where you can gulp down Guinness and dance the whole night. Friday nights you can spend in Funk Club. When it comes to food and drink, Perth offers the most amazing of the culinary experience. Taste a sushi in Matsuri, a Japanese restaurant. Nibble babecue pork, roast duck and noodles at Good Fortune Roast Duck House. Go spicy on those taste buds with Annalakshmi, and indulge in the grilled rock lobster at Fraser's Restaurant. Tarts and Soto Espresso are cafes where you can have a hearty breakfast along with tea and coffee. Besides do not forget to make a visit to Jackson's (Modern Australian), Viet Hoa (Vietnamese), Red Teapot (Chinese), Chutney Mary's (Indian) and Must Winebar (French). Perth is also a great place where you can shop without knowing how deep is your pocket. Bag here books, clothing, indigenous art pieces, accessories, art and craft items, design things, maps and things related to music. For clothing go to Varga Girl, Keith & Lottie and Wheels & Doll Baby. About Qantas Airways

The Qantas Airways is one of the leading airlines in Australia as it has developed gradually in tandem with the civil aviation development in the continent. Queensland and Northern Territory Aerial Services Ltd, knows as Qantas, was established on 16th November 1920 by Sir Hudson Fysh KBE DFC, Paul McGinness DFC DCM and Sir Fergus McMaster. Presently, Qantas Airways is one of the leading of the world. With world-class hospitality, low air fare, cheap air tickets, online booking service and comprehensive schedule, Qantas Airways has become favourite of the passengers. Around July-September 1959 Qantas Airways acquired seven Boeing 707-138 jet aircrafts. This let the airline expand its route network to more destinations around the world and serve more passengers with Qantas Airways flights. The national animal of Australia, Kangaroo, features on the logo of the airline and its design is adopted from one penny coin of Australia. British Airways bid for a 25 per cent stake in Qantas with an investment worth 665 million Australian dollars in December 1992 and acquired the same in March 1993. Qantas Airways celebrated its 75th anniversary in 1995 and introduced a new logo of a winged kangaroo with words 75 years to mark the milestone.
